Wrath was sitting in his throne, his look one of distant longing, his arms resting upright, the cuts forever etched into them visible and bleeding, his body small in comparison to the sheer size of the cold, dark, metallic throne and the piles of bodies lying around it.
Char always hated approaching him in times like these, moments after he has sated is anger and hatred. But then again it could be worse, he could have come in when Wrath was in the middle of his frenzy, he had only done it four times, but those four times were more than enough to last a millennia. His hands fiddled with his shirt, a nervous habit he had come to use, pulling on loose strings, he had gone through several hundred shirts because of it.
He approached the throne, stepping over and around bodies of the lifeless souls who had lived their lives in hatred and anger, only to be cut down by the ultimate one, the sin of Wrath himself. But they would be reborn again the next day to suffer the same trials, an ever ongoing process.
Char never understood the purpose as he glided up the stairs before the throne, stooping to pick up a pocket watch that sat in a limp hand, cleaning the blood off of it and pocketing it. He remembered they had called the process “purging”. He had reached the foot of the throne, his hands once again fidgeting with his shirt as he cleared his throat. Wrath paid him no heed, still staring into the distance, lost in his own thoughts.
“Master Wrath…” Char called to him softly, getting no response. “Master Wrath…” He reached out and touched Wrath’s hand, bringing Wrath back from his reverie. He blinked slowly, shaking his head slightly as he looked down at Char.

“Char.”

“Sir… uh… Pride is requesting an audience.”

“Heh, is that what he calls it now? An ‘audience’.” Wrath responded spitting out the last part like it was poison.
“He…he uh… wants you to go see him. He’s meeting with all six of you at once.”

“No doubt he wants to brag… wait. Did you say he is meeting with all six of us at once?” Wrath looked sternly at Char, an eyebrow cocked.

“Yes sir.” Char replied, avoiding his stare, instead focusing on his shirt, he seemed to have managed to unravel a good portion of it. Another shirt wasted it seemed.

“Was there to be anyone else?”

“Not that he mentioned, just the sins.”

“Interesting…” Wrath turned his arms, holding onto the edge of the arms on the throne, his fingers lacing into the eye sockets of the skulls on the end and pushing himself off of it, landing with a soft thud on a body at the foot of the throne, Char stepped aside quickly as Wrath walked down the stone steps, not bothering to avoid the bodies like Char did as he followed him.
Char glanced around the room, never able to adjust himself properly to cold, bare walls, windows sitting high and narrow, filtering in barely enough light from the ruby red skies outside, the only other source being the large opened doors leading out into the ruined castle. This room was the only one intact and he hated it. He stole a quick glance to the eyes peering out from the shadows, demons, all of them, hating the light and waiting until dark to feast on the corpses. However, they, like him had learned to avoid this place whenever Wrath was on a killing spree. He despised them, they were the fallen, the vocal minority, soldiers to Lucifer, turned by their own corruption into the very things they once despised themselves.
They paused in the ruined courtyard, Wrath looking up at the sky, a distant look on his face again. Char looked around casually, pulling out the pocket watch and opening it. The clockwork was of course broken, the hands on the face of the clock forever locked into the exact moment in time when its original owner passed over. It read 5:24. Wrath looked back at him, giving Char an amused look.

“What time is it?” He joked, Char looking up at him, snapping the watch closed and shrugged.

“Hell if I know.” He pocketed the watch again. Wrath nodded sagely, as if confirming something to himself and walked up to Char, hand outstretched. “I just got this watch.” Char sighed, pulling it back out and dropping it in Wrath’s hand, the cold brass glinting slightly in the light. Wrath studied it carefully, holding onto the chain and watching it spin slowly in the air, the reflection of the light dancing across his face before his blood started to drip down onto it. He wrapped the chain around his hand, bringing the watch back up and popping it open, staring at the clock face inside.
“5:24.” He murmured listlessly, snapping it shut and handing it back to Char. “Well now,” He mused, pulling out some bandaging from one pocket and starting to wrap his wounds, “I guess I best get going huh? I hate Pride though, Greed too. You can never trust Greed.” He looked back and up at Char, studying his face. “Funny to think we’re all related…”

-From the memoirs of Cameron De Maerceiles
